Palmer Township, Pa., Main Street, Serious MVA with Entrapment 09/23/2025

 

Palmer Township, PA — Emergency services responded to the intersection of Main Street and the Route 33 interchange shortly after 5:00 a.m. for a motor vehicle collision involving a tractor-trailer, which left two occupants heavily entrapped.

Multiple 911 calls reported a passenger vehicle lodged beneath the side of a tractor-trailer, with two patients classified as priority one. While en route, Deputy Chief 2751 requested a rapid response for a heavy wrecker to assist with extrication, along with additional support from the Upper Nazareth Fire Department.

Upon arrival, firefighters confirmed a single vehicle pinned beneath the tractor-trailer, with severe intrusion into the driver’s compartment. Thanks to the rapid response of the wrecker company, crews were able to lift the rear of the trailer, remove the vehicle from underneath, and extricate the two patients.

Suburban EMS and Nazareth EMS transported both patients to St Luke's Trauma Center. Photo Gallery
